Abstract

The utility model discloses a protection device for a bending machine, and relates to the field of bending machines. The utility model comprises a supporting table surface and a workpiece, wherein a pressing plate is arranged above the supporting table surface, a protection mechanism is arranged below the pressing plate, the protection mechanism comprises two groups of guide frames, one side of each guide frame is fixedly provided with a mounting plate, the mounting plates are movably connected with the pressing plate, the two groups of guide frames are in mirror symmetry structures, when the pressing part limits pressing the workpiece through the protection mechanism, the first electric push rod drives the pressing plate to drive the workpiece to rotate at a synchronous angle through the protection mechanism, the distance between the workpiece and the supporting table surface in the process and the hand contact position of the operator are gradually increased, the distance between the workpiece and the pressing plate is fixed through the guiding limiting function of the guide frame, the error entering of the hand of the operator into the gap is effectively prevented, the risk of injury to the hand of the operator in the bending process is directly avoided, and the use safety is remarkably improved.

Description

Protection device for bending machine Technical Field The utility model relates to the field of bending machines, in particular to a protective device for a bending machine. Background The bending machine is also called a bending machine, is mechanical equipment for bending metal plates, drives a die to move relatively through a hydraulic system or a mechanical transmission system, realizes bending forming of the plates, has various types including manual, hydraulic, numerical control and the like, has various characteristics, and is suitable for processing requirements of different scales and precision. The traditional plate folding machine needs to manually place the plate which is not bent on the plate folding machine in the using process, then the plate is limited and pressed, and meanwhile the plate is bent by matching with a plate folding mechanism, but the plate folding machine has a problem in the actual using process, in particular to the operation of placing the plate between the clamping part and the operating platform, and an operator places hands in a gap between the plate and the clamping part, so that certain potential safety hazards exist. Disclosure of utility model Accordingly, the present utility model is directed to a protection device for a bending machine, which solves the technical problem that an operator is at risk of misplacing a hand in a gap between a plate and a clamping portion when placing the plate between the clamping portion and an operation table. The protection device for the bending machine comprises a supporting table top and a workpiece, wherein a pressing plate is arranged above the supporting table top, a protection mechanism is arranged below the pressing plate, the protection mechanism comprises two groups of guide frames, one side of each guide frame is fixedly provided with a mounting plate, the mounting plate is movably connected with the pressing plate, and the two groups of guide frames are in mirror symmetry structures and are used for limiting the workpiece. Through adopting above-mentioned technical scheme, two sets of guide frames that are mirror symmetry structure provide accurate limit function for the work piece, guaranteed stability and the accuracy of work piece in the in-process of bending, effectively prevented the work piece because of removing or the skew error of bending that leads to, simultaneously, the guide frame with support the swing joint of clamp plate for the device can adapt to the work piece of different width, has improved the commonality and the flexibility of device. Further, the cross section of the guide frame is of an L-shaped structure, and a guide inclined plate is arranged at the end head of the guide frame and used for guiding the workpiece to the inner side of the guide frame. Through adopting above-mentioned technical scheme, not only strengthened the structural strength of guide frame, still provided good guide performance for it, the direction swash plate that the end set up can guide the work piece to get into the guide frame inboard smoothly, has reduced the resistance and the friction of work piece in placing the in-process, has improved operating efficiency. Further, the mounting plate is in sliding connection with the pressing plate and is in fastening connection through a mounting bolt so as to adapt to the width dimension of the workpiece. Through adopting above-mentioned technical scheme for protection machanism can adjust according to different work piece width dimensions, has improved adaptability and the flexibility of device, through the fastening connection of mounting bolt, can ensure protection machanism stability and reliability after the adjustment, has prevented the bending error that leads to because of not hard up or rocking. Further, the inside rotation of guide frame is provided with a plurality of gyro wheels, and a plurality of gyro wheels are equidistant linear arrangement, the gyro wheel is damping rubber gyro wheel. By adopting the technical scheme, good supporting and rolling performances are provided for the workpiece in the bending process, friction and resistance between the workpiece and the guide frame are reduced, and abrasion and scratch risks on the surface of the workpiece are reduced. Further, the supporting table top is supported by two side supporting side plates and the ground, a first electric push rod and a second electric push rod are rotatably arranged on one side of each supporting side plate, and the first electric push rod and the second electric push rod are electrically connected with an external power supply through a controller. Through adopting above-mentioned technical scheme, first electric putter and second electric putter have realized the automation and the intelligent control of device, have not only improved operating efficiency and accuracy, have still reduced operating personnel's intensity of labour and security risk.
